I'm using MimeTokenStream to parse json from a multi part http response using
the code below. But I get the following exception
"org.apache.james.mime4j.io.MaxLineLimitException: Maximum line length limit
(1000) exceeded" mime4j can not work with anything more than 1000 characters?
MimeTokenStream stream = new MimeTokenStream();
stream.parse(inputStream);
for (EntityState state = stream.getState(); state !=
EntityState.T_END_OF_STREAM; state = stream.next()) {
switch (state) {
case T_BODY:
System.out.println("Body detected,
contents = " + stream.getInputStream() + ", header data = "
+
stream.getBodyDescriptor());
break;
case T_FIELD:
System.out.println("Header field
detected: " + stream.getField());
break;
case T_START_MULTIPART:
System.out.println("Multipart message
detexted," + " header data = " + stream.getBodyDescriptor());
}
}